Output 3c8c8d805c46139153698f60b18aad28d1a1d4c6ebaf82a645128b691b22dcec:10

value
70236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c20071fda160b41ace19bf65fdf21095f1b3bc OP_EQUAL
address
3A4BpUeWVbLXFy3sz5rSJk6tZWYY8dR3bp
transaction
3c8c8d805c46139153698f60b18aad28d1a1d4c6ebaf82a645128b691b22dcec
confirmations
200735
spent
true